4.4 Purge gas connecon
4.4.1 Recommended purge gas ow
The recommended purge gas ow for typical applicaons is 25 sccm (0.42 mbar l s
-1
,
42 Pa l s
-1
). The ow protects the pump when you pump the oxygen in concentraons
more than 20% by volume.
The ow rate of the purge gas must be in a range given in Purge gas specicaon on
page 23. To limit the ow rate, use a ow controller or a pressure regulator and
calibrated ow restrictor. The PRX10 purge restrictor accessory is applicable for the
purpose. Refer to Accessories on page 92.
4.4.2 Connect the purge gas
Note:
The purge gas must comply with the specicaon given in Purge gas specicaon on
page 23.
1. To supply the purge gas to the pump, remove the plug installed in the purge port.
2. To install a vent port adaptor, refer to Accessories on page 92.
3. Connect the purge gas supply to the vent port adaptor.
4.5 Electrical installaon
WARNING: ELECTRICAL INSTALLATION
Make sure that the electrical installaon of the pump is in accordance with the
regional and local codes and conforms to local and naonal safety requirements. The
pump must be connected to an applicable power supply unit with an applicable earth
(ground) point.
Make sure that the qualied person does the electrical installaon. Do the electrical
connecons of the pump aer the pump is installed on the vacuum system. Disconnect
all electrical connecons from the pump before you remove it from the vacuum system.
Do the grounding of the pump using the given connecon. Refer to Ground the
connecons on page 38.
You can operate the pump using the manufacturer's TIC Turbo Instrument Controller,
TIC Turbo Controller (refer to Connect the logic interface to the TIC on page 38) or using
the customer system. Refer to Connect the logic interface to the customer control
